I have skyrim special edition downloaded via steam, I used to just install mods via the main menu, realised today I couldn't find a mod I wanted but was pretty sure it still existed. I found the mod on nexus and decided to download vortex to handle all my mods, it keeps coming up with "plug dependencies unfufilled", when I click on more then it tells me "some of the enabled plugins have dependencies or incompatibilities that are not obeyes in your current setup:" and it then gives me a link to skyrim special edition script extender 64 https://skse.silverlock.org/

 

I've tried installing it via steam and it hasn't worked, when clicking on installer and trying to install it then "the installer was unable to determine your Skyrim install diresctory. please set the install directory to the folder containing TESV.exe". I've tried typing tesv on the search bar and it isn't anywhere in my files at all.

 

I've even tried looking up the tesv thing, I've looked in every single file in my Skyrim Special edition folder and every time I try to install the Skyrim script extender it says "The Skyrim EXE file was not found in the install directory. You have probably not selected the correct folder."

 

Not really sure what to do at this point, I'm not really that tech savvy but I know how to follow instructions. If anyone could help me out I'd greatly appreciate it.

Which Skyrim are you playing?

 

Skyrim SE or Skyrim LE, because the only SKSE that's available on Steam is for Skyrim LE

 

Also, are you installing mods for the correct version of Skyrim?

 

You can't install Skyrim LE mods on Skyrim SE, or vice versa
